Plant diseases cause billions of dollars in crop losses annually and can devastate home gardens and landscapes. Early identification is critical for effective treatment, yet most plant owners — from commercial farmers to hobbyist gardeners — lack the expertise to distinguish between bacterial, fungal, viral, and nutrient-deficiency symptoms that often look similar to untrained eyes. AI plant disease tools analyze leaf photographs to identify specific diseases, assess severity, recommend treatments, and track disease progression over time. These tools bring plant pathology expertise to anyone with a smartphone.

Top Pick: Plantix
Plantix leads the plant disease identification category with an AI trained on the largest database of crop disease images in the world, covering over 500 diseases, pests, and nutrient deficiencies across 60 major crop species. Photograph an affected leaf, and the app returns the most likely diagnosis within seconds, along with the pathogen or deficiency responsible, disease lifecycle information, and specific treatment recommendations including both chemical and organic options.
What distinguishes Plantix is the depth of its diagnostic output. Beyond identifying the disease, the AI assesses severity on a standardized scale, estimates yield impact if left untreated, and provides region-specific treatment timing based on weather and growing conditions. The platform maintains a disease history for each user’s fields, tracking outbreaks over seasons and alerting when conditions favor recurrence of previously detected diseases.
Plantix has been validated in peer-reviewed agricultural research and is used by extension services in over 30 countries. Its offline mode allows diagnosis in remote agricultural areas without internet connectivity, a practical necessity for many farming communities. The app is free for individual farmers, with premium analytics available for commercial operations.
Runner-Up: PictureThis Disease ID
PictureThis extends its popular plant identification platform with a disease detection module that excels for home gardens, ornamental plants, and landscaping species that agricultural tools often neglect. The AI recognizes diseases on over 17,000 plant species including houseplants, flowers, shrubs, and trees alongside common vegetables and fruits.
The disease identification provides visual matching with annotated reference photos showing disease progression stages, helping users confirm the AI diagnosis against their own observations. Treatment recommendations are tailored for home garden scale, favoring accessible solutions over commercial agricultural products.
Best Free Option: PlantVillage AI
PlantVillage, developed at Penn State University, offers a free open-source plant disease detection system built on a publicly available dataset of over 50,000 expert-labeled disease images. While its crop coverage is narrower than Plantix, it provides reliable disease identification for major staple crops and has been specifically designed for accessibility in developing regions where crop disease has the greatest food security impact.
How We Evaluated
We tested each tool using 300 verified disease samples across 25 crop and ornamental species, with diagnoses confirmed by certified plant pathologists. Scoring weighted diagnostic accuracy at the disease level (35%), treatment recommendation quality reviewed by agricultural scientists (25%), crop and species coverage breadth (20%), severity assessment accuracy (10%), and offline and low-connectivity functionality (10%).
